Type of Ride: Street
Where: Rincon CA USA
Road/Route: Route 76
Size/Distance: 35 miles
California Route 76 winds through the mountains of the Cleveland National Forest just northeast of Escondido, California. It's been called Southern California's most technical road- and it just might be.
Smooth pavement makes for a great ride. Hairpins and tight switchbacks means you'd better leave the running boards at home! But watch for decreasing radius turns that could ruin your whole day.
Pick it up off I-15 and head east. When you get to Lake Henshaw, take a break then turn around and do it again!
